Improve Stealth Mode - it is currently detected by Google
While using Stealth Mode, YouTube is now consistently asking me to sign in, to "prove that I am not a bot". This did not happen in the past. When disconnecting from Proton VPN, YouTube no longer is asking for a sign in. So obviously Google is able to detect the difference between a "Stealth" connection and a normal connection. This would disqualify this protocol as being "Stealth". Please improve Stealth Mode.

What? Stealth is just a method to connect to a VPN server, that's it. Services only see you connecting from the server, not how you have connected to it.

Stealth mode is used to bypass blocks in your network, not something where you wanna go, steal exist, just to bypass restrictions like censorship in countries

In theory, whether or not you use privacy mode only affects your own traffic and won't affect how Google sees your traffic. Google technically cannot know this; it might be your misconception, or the server IP configured with privacy mode might just be under Google's risk control.
